Study on Player Behavior and Engagement
Goals
The primary aim of this study was to analyze how player engagement tactics affect gambling behavior in Europa online casinos. Researchers focused on understanding which features enhance player retention and satisfaction.
Methods
The study employed a mixed-methods approach, utilizing both quantitative surveys and qualitative interviews with over 2,000 players across multiple platforms. Participants provided insights into their gaming preferences, experiences, and motivations for playing.
Results
Findings revealed that personalization and loyalty rewards significantly influence player satisfaction. Players who received tailored game recommendations based on their previous behavior reported a >30% increase in engagement time. Furthermore, loyalty programs that included tiered rewards led to higher retention rates, particularly among high-frequency players.
Impact of Mobile Gaming on Online Casinos
Goals
This research aimed to evaluate how the rise of mobile gaming has transformed the landscape of Europa online casinos, particularly in regard to accessibility and player demographics.
Methods
Researchers analyzed data from mobile casino apps, focusing on user demographics, frequency of gameplay, and the average time spent gaming. Surveys were also distributed to gather feedback on user experience.
Results
The study concluded that *mobile gaming is responsible for approximately 60% of online casino revenue in Europe*. Notably, younger players (ages 18-34) favored mobile platforms, showing a distinct preference for quick-play games and social gambling features. This trend indicates a shift in the target demographic for many online casinos, prompting operators to prioritize mobile-friendly interfaces and engaging content.
Technological Advances Shaping Online Gambling
Goals
This study explored how advancements in technology, particularly artificial intelligence (AI) and blockchain, are reshaping the online casino experience.
Methods
Researchers conducted a comparative analysis of various online casinos that have integrated AI and blockchain technologies, assessing their impact on game fairness, security, and customer service.
Results
Results showed that casinos utilizing AI for customer support achieved 50% faster response times and increased customer satisfaction ratings by 22%. Additionally, blockchain integration not only improved transaction security but also enhanced transparency, leading to a rise in player trust. As a result, sites utilizing these technologies reported a significant increase in player retention.
Future Trends in Online Gambling
Goals
This analysis aimed to forecast the future of online gambling, particularly focusing on regulatory changes and social gaming trends.
Methods
Expert interviews and analysis of existing market data were conducted to identify key trends. A survey of over 1,500 industry stakeholders provided insights into expected developments in the online casino landscape.
Results
Several trends emerged, with a particular emphasis on increased regulation aiming to protect players while ensuring fair play. Additionally, the study indicated a growing interest in social gaming, integrating aspects of traditional casinos with online platforms. The rise of live dealer games was highlighted as a major trend that enhances social interaction among players.
